I try to convert the stars into meanings, my sad feelings. If you wanted to know how I tie my shoes, follow me into the blue and you'll see. I breathe softly but my tears corrupt my speaking. Don't leave me. Walk with me, climb the trees. The worms in the ground colonize, I see it with my eyes. The wind makes the day so delicate, but I still feel the sadness. The ink bleeds onto the paper like the raindrops from yesterday. Garden gnomes look at me. All my time spent with you and your left to choose after I do, but its your choice if you're coming back. Flowers blossom into lies. The rope hangs from the tree and my hands grasp it, the silence graces me, but you can't justify it. Wind chimes ring. The grass never grew greener on my side. And here I lie, down on the clouds floating through the sky. I'm not ok, but thats ok. I'll never find a way without you. Come with me into the blue..
